news 2026/3/14 13:17:55

MindElixir终极指南:5分钟构建专业级思维导图应用

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
MindElixir终极指南:5分钟构建专业级思维导图应用

MindElixir终极指南:5分钟构建专业级思维导图应用

【免费下载链接】mind-elixir-core⚗ Mind-elixir is a framework agnostic mind map core.项目地址: https://gitcode.com/gh_mirrors/mi/mind-elixir-core

在信息爆炸的时代,如何高效组织和呈现复杂信息成为每个开发者和知识工作者面临的挑战。MindElixir作为一款框架无关的开源思维导图核心库,为这一难题提供了优雅的解决方案。这款轻量级、高性能的思维导图渲染引擎,让你无论使用Vue、React、Angular还是原生JavaScript,都能轻松集成专业的思维导图功能。

🚀 快速入门:5分钟搭建思维导图

MindElixir的安装和使用极其简单,即使是技术新手也能快速上手。通过npm安装核心库后,只需几行代码即可创建功能完整的思维导图应用。

环境准备与安装步骤:

npm install mind-elixir-core

基础集成代码示例:

import MindElixir from 'mind-elixir-core' import 'mind-elixir-core/dist/mind-elixir.css' // 创建思维导图实例 const mindMap = new MindElixir({ el: '#mindmap-container', direction: MindElixir.LEFT, data: MindElixir.new('我的第一个思维导图') }) // 初始化渲染 mindMap.init()

在HTML中添加容器元素即可完成基础设置:

<div id="mindmap-container" style="width: 100%; height: 600px;"></div>

✨ 核心功能深度解析

智能节点管理系统

MindElixir提供了丰富的节点操作功能,让信息组织变得轻松高效:

  • 快速创建节点:使用Tab键创建子节点,Enter键创建同级节点
  • 批量操作支持:多选节点进行复制、移动、删除等操作
  • 样式定制自由:支持字体、颜色、背景、图标等个性化设置

高效交互体验优化

思维导图支持多种交互模式,提升用户体验:

  • 直观拖拽重构:轻松调整节点层级关系
  • 智能聚焦模式:右键快速切换专注视图
  • 全面快捷键支持:F1居中、Ctrl+S保存等快捷操作

数据流转与导出功能

支持多种格式的数据处理,满足不同场景需求:

  • JSON导入导出:便于数据备份和团队协作
  • 高质量图像导出:生成PNG、SVG格式的思维导图
  • HTML直接输出:轻松嵌入网页展示

🏗️ 实际应用场景指南

项目管理与任务分解实践

使用MindElixir可以将复杂的项目拆解为清晰的任务结构。每个项目节点可以包含子任务、负责人、截止日期等详细信息,帮助团队成员直观理解项目全貌和进度安排。

学习笔记与知识整理技巧

学生和教育工作者可以利用思维导图整理学科知识点,建立知识之间的关联网络。这种视觉化的学习方式能够显著提升学习效率和记忆效果。

会议记录与头脑风暴应用

在团队会议中实时构建思维导图,有效捕捉讨论要点和决策过程。形成的结构化会议纪要便于后续查阅和行动跟踪。

🔧 生态系统集成方案

MindElixir拥有丰富的插件生态,支持多种前端框架:

  • React组件集成:mind-elixir-react
  • Vue组件适配:mind-elixir-vue
  • 自定义节点菜单:@mind-elixir/node-menu
  • 高级导出工具:@mind-elixir/export

💡 进阶使用与性能优化

自定义主题开发指南

通过CSS变量系统,你可以轻松创建符合品牌风格的思维导图主题:

:root { --main-color: #1890ff; --bg-color: #f5f5f5; --node-padding: 8px 12px; }

性能优化最佳实践

  • 大型导图处理:使用懒加载技术优化性能
  • 节点管理策略:合理使用节点折叠功能,避免一次性渲染过多内容
  • 数据缓存方案:利用本地存储缓存数据,提升用户体验

📊 最佳实践与建议

在实际项目中应用MindElixir时,建议遵循以下原则:

  1. 渐进式集成策略:先实现基础功能,再逐步添加高级特性
  2. 用户引导设计:为新用户提供清晰的操作指引
  3. 数据安全备份:定期导出重要思维导图数据
  4. 响应式设计保障:确保在不同设备上都有良好的显示效果

通过MindElixir,你可以快速构建功能丰富、交互流畅的思维导图应用。无论是个人知识管理还是团队协作,都能获得出色的使用体验。这款开源工具的强大功能和易用性,让它成为信息时代不可或缺的思维整理利器。

【免费下载链接】mind-elixir-core⚗ Mind-elixir is a framework agnostic mind map core.项目地址: https://gitcode.com/gh_mirrors/mi/mind-elixir-core

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/3/12 21:07:51

5步彻底解决1Panel部署OpenResty失败的终极指南

在使用1Panel面板进行OpenResty部署时&#xff0c;很多运维人员都遭遇过令人沮丧的安装失败问题。作为新一代Linux服务器运维管理面板&#xff0c;1Panel虽然在简化服务器管理方面表现出色&#xff0c;但在特定应用部署过程中仍存在一些技术挑战。本文将为你提供一套完整的解决…

作者头像 李华
网站建设 2026/3/13 22:11:36

Meld可视化差异工具:开发者的效率提升终极指南

Meld可视化差异工具&#xff1a;开发者的效率提升终极指南 【免费下载链接】meld Read-only mirror of https://gitlab.gnome.org/GNOME/meld 项目地址: https://gitcode.com/gh_mirrors/me/meld 在日常开发工作中&#xff0c;你是否曾经为复杂的代码冲突而头疼不已&…

作者头像 李华
网站建设 2026/3/10 19:21:55

终极指南:3分钟用Files文件管理器搞定SSH远程服务器文件操作

终极指南&#xff1a;3分钟用Files文件管理器搞定SSH远程服务器文件操作 【免费下载链接】Files Building the best file manager for Windows 项目地址: https://gitcode.com/gh_mirrors/fi/Files 还在为复杂的SSH命令行操作而烦恼吗&#xff1f;Files文件管理器让远程…

作者头像 李华
网站建设 2026/3/13 8:06:23

Open-AutoGLM如何守护未成年人隐私?这3个关键设置你必须掌握

第一章&#xff1a;Open-AutoGLM如何守护未成年人隐私&#xff1f;这3个关键设置你必须掌握在人工智能应用日益普及的背景下&#xff0c;Open-AutoGLM 作为一款强大的语言模型工具&#xff0c;其在处理未成年人相关数据时的隐私保护机制尤为重要。正确配置系统设置不仅能符合《…

作者头像 李华
网站建设 2026/3/13 18:54:40

Open-AutoGLM权限管理体系深度解析(20年专家实战经验倾囊相授)

第一章&#xff1a;Open-AutoGLM权限分级管控概述Open-AutoGLM作为面向企业级AI应用的自动化语言模型平台&#xff0c;其核心安全机制依赖于精细化的权限分级管控体系。该体系通过角色、资源与操作的三元组控制模型&#xff0c;实现对用户行为的最小权限约束&#xff0c;保障系…

作者头像 李华
网站建设 2026/3/11 15:04:10

5分钟快速上手Catch2事件监听器:终极测试监控解决方案

5分钟快速上手Catch2事件监听器&#xff1a;终极测试监控解决方案 【免费下载链接】Catch2 A modern, C-native, test framework for unit-tests, TDD and BDD - using C14, C17 and later (C11 support is in v2.x branch, and C03 on the Catch1.x branch) 项目地址: https…

作者头像 李华